     33 // The BackendContext contains all of the base Vulkan objects needed by the GrVkGpu. The assumption
     34 // is that the client will set these up and pass them to the GrVkGpu constructor. The VkDevice
     35 // created must support at least one graphics queue, which is passed in as well.
     36 // The QueueFamilyIndex must match the family of the given queue. It is needed for CommandPool
     37 // creation, and any GrBackendObjects handed to us (e.g., for wrapped textures) need to be created
     38 // in or transitioned to that family.
     39 struct GrVkBackendContext : public SkRefCnt {
     40     VkInstance                 fInstance;
     41     VkPhysicalDevice           fPhysicalDevice;
     42     VkDevice                   fDevice;
     43     VkQueue                    fQueue;
     44     uint32_t                   fGraphicsQueueIndex;
     45     uint32_t                   fMinAPIVersion;
     46     uint32_t                   fExtensions;
     47     uint32_t                   fFeatures;
     48     sk_sp<const GrVkInterface> fInterface;
     49 
     50     using CanPresentFn = std::function<bool(VkInstance, VkPhysicalDevice,
     51                                             uint32_t queueFamilyIndex)>;
     52 
     53     // Helper function to create the default Vulkan objects needed by the GrVkGpu object
     54     // If presentQueueIndex is non-NULL, will try to set up presentQueue as part of device
     55     // creation using the platform-specific canPresent() function.
     56     static const GrVkBackendContext* Create(uint32_t* presentQueueIndex = nullptr,
     57                                             CanPresentFn = CanPresentFn());
     58 
     59     ~GrVkBackendContext() override;
     60 };
